A writing surface built around rhythm, focus, and Markdown.

Codex renders Markdown as you write while the document itself remains Markdown. Three distinct themes, four curated typography systems, and fine control over size, line height, paragraph rhythm, and measure let the page fit the work.

Focus Display and Fixed Scrolling hold attention where it belongs. Tables keep their structure, Synapse appears on the selection when invited, and eight export templates carry the same source into PDF or DOCX.

Does changing a theme alter the Markdown?

No. Themes and font systems change the visual surface; the Markdown source stays intact.

What does Fixed Scrolling do?

It keeps the active line near the top, center, or bottom while the document moves one line at a time.

What can Codex export?

Eight production templates are available for PDF and DOCX output.
